Flavor is one of the most critical purchasing factors for beverage consumers. As Drink Mixes and Powdered Drinks continue to expand in foodservice and retail markets, buyers often face a key decision: choose natural flavor formulations or artificial ones. Each delivers different taste experiences, regulatory implications, and cost-performance benefits.
Natural Flavor Drink Mixes
Natural flavors are derived from real food sources such as fruits, herbs, and spices. These Drink Mixes are favored by health-conscious consumers seeking authenticity.
Taste advantages:
More layered and complex profiles
Closely replicates the original fruit or ingredient
Fresher aroma and mouthfeel
Common applications:
Premium beverage menus
Cold-pressed style fruit drinks
Specialty cafes and wellness retailers
However, natural flavors can be more expensive and have taste variations due to seasonal ingredient differences.
Artificial Flavor Drink Mixes
Artificial flavors are developed to mimic natural tastes with stable and predictable outcomes. In Powdered Drinks, they offer precise flavor control and high consistency.
Taste advantages:
Strong, bold, and recognizable flavor notes
Highly stable across shelf life
Reliable taste regardless of batch
These formulations support cost-effective beverage programs while still appealing to mainstream palates.

Consumer Preference and Market Positioning
Natural-flavored Drink Mixes carry a premium perception and align well with clean-label trends. They often target:
Health and wellness segments
Plant-based beverage categories
Functional drink innovation
Artificial-based Powdered Drinks remain popular in value-driven markets where taste intensity and affordability are key selling points.
Aroma and Aftertaste Differences
Natural flavors typically deliver a smoother finish and gradual flavor release, enhancing the sensory experience.
Artificial flavors may offer stronger initial impact but can sometimes result in a more noticeable aftertaste — depending on formulation quality.
For B2B beverage developers, the choice depends on the desired style:
- Natural = authentic, subtle
- Artificial = bold, high-impact
Hybrid Formulas Combining Both Strengths
Many manufacturers now produce Drink Mixes that blend natural and artificial ingredients to achieve:
Balanced cost
Improved stability
Enhanced fruit realism
Strong consumer acceptance
This allows brands to maintain premium taste at competitive pricing.
